May I suggest, that since you acquired a new camera, buy some supplemental lighting and do away with the flash. You will have to use the manual settings on the camera however, but your photos will look light years better. You don’t have to spend alot, just 3 clamp on fixtures with 100 watt daylight bulbs will do. Try to light the model from 3 different angles. That’s a great looking jet btw.
